1957 Fairthorpe Electron vs. 2010 Mazda BT-50
To start off, 2010 Mazda BT-50 is newer by 53 year(s). Which means there will be less support and parts availability for 1957 Fairthorpe Electron. In addition, the cost of maintenance, including insurance, on 1957 Fairthorpe Electron would be higher. At 2,953 cc (4 cylinders), 2010 Mazda BT-50 is equipped with a bigger engine. In terms of performance, 2010 Mazda BT-50 (154 HP @ 3200 RPM) has 71 more horse power than 1957 Fairthorpe Electron. (83 HP @ 6800 RPM) In normal driving conditions, 2010 Mazda BT-50 should accelerate faster than 1957 Fairthorpe Electron.
Because 2010 Mazda BT-50 is four wheel drive (4WD), it will have significant more traction and grip than 1957 Fairthorpe Electron. In wet, icy, snow, or gravel driving conditions, 2010 Mazda BT-50 will offer significantly more control. With that said, do keep in mind that many other factors such as speed and the wear on your tires can also have significant impact on traction and control. Let's talk about torque, 2010 Mazda BT-50 (380 Nm @ 180 RPM) has 281 more torque (in Nm) than 1957 Fairthorpe Electron. (99 Nm @ 4750 RPM). This means 2010 Mazda BT-50 will have an easier job in driving up hills or pulling heavy equipment than 1957 Fairthorpe Electron.
